Job Summary The Replenishment Associate is responsible for accurately picking orders in a designated area and moving products using a cherry picker based on assigned task sheets. This role requires experience operating forklifts and other power equipment. Associates scan multiple bins, transport products to specified locations, and maintain safety, sanitation, and security standards within a logistics environment. Flexibility to assist with inventory control and shipment preparation is expected.
